Review of My Fair Lady (1964) by Les E — 05 Jul 2009
Bloomin loverly. Adorable Audrey plays a low flower girl turned into a lady. There are so many great songs but none get in thew way of the story. Several of the scenes are fantastic. When we first meet Elizas dad London wakes up slowly, great.
Then when Eliza goes to Ascot every syllable is special. Harrison and Hyde-White are perfect for their parts and Hepburn is perfect for any part. Although 3 hours long the story deserves every minute.
